Small Block Windage Trays

Trays are the same for 273/318/340. 360 had wider spacing on the main cap bolts, and require a different tray. DC then simply slotted the mounting holes to accommodate all engines.
273/318 used slightly shorter main bolts, and the 340 bolts *could* bottom out when used in the smaller engines (or was it the factory main caps were a touch shorter on the small motors? Old age is catching up with me...), so DC included hardened washers in their tray hardware packages for use on 273/318s to alleviate that problem (You know, the ones that everybody keeps asking "What are these for?"). Factory (HP)318s used shorter bolts, but they were standardized in the DC package, thus the washers.
